
Cost of Garden Plant Removal in Sacramento
Garden plant removal in Sacramento, CA, can be a necessary task for homeowners looking to maintain or redesign their outdoor spaces. Whether it's removing overgrown shrubs, dead trees, or invasive species,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Plant: Larger plants or trees typically require more labor and equipment for removal, increasing the overall cost.
- Accessibility: If the plant is difficult to access, such as being located in a cramped space or behind other structures, the removal process can be more complicated and costly.
- Type of Plant: Some plants have extensive root systems or thorns that make removal more labor-intensive, affecting the price.
- Disposal Requirements: The cost can rise if the plant material needs to be hauled away and disposed of in a specific manner.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Sacramento can influence the overall cost, with skilled labor generally costing more.
- Seasonality: Prices may vary depending on the season, with higher costs typically seen during peak gardening months.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Sacramento, CA) |
---|---|
Small Shrub Removal | $50 - $100 |
Medium-Sized Tree Removal | $200 - $500 |
Large Tree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Stump Grinding | $100 - $300 |
Root Removal | $150 - $400 |
Debris Haul Away | $50 - $150 |
Hourly Labor Rate | $50 - $100 per hour |
